Teachers On Reserve Blog. Thursday, April 17, 2014. Games that Promote Learning. Who doesn’t love playing games? And as a substitute teacher they are an invaluable learning tool when you are left sans lesson plans or there is extra time after the lessons have been completed. They have the potential to be a great addition to any lesson, lecture or test review. Classic games like hangman, bingo and jeopardy are always a crowd favorite. These are great because they can be modified for any subject.

Teachers On Reserve Blog. Monday, February 24, 2014. Get to Know your Neighbor. Substitute teachers face a variety of challenges each day. Each job is a new and challenging environment: Different personnel, students, physical plant, educational philosophy, discipline policy, lesson plans, safety procedures, driving directions….Whether you are the new substitute teacher or the receiving school it is important to make connections straight away.
